1977 TOYOTA LAND CRUISER. Original and unmolested or restored. It has spent its entire life in Colorado. The miles are original. Everything is original and and in working order. The 2F engine starts easily and runs smooth, it idles and drives great. I would drive it anywhere. The vehicle was first owned by a couple from Aspen that owned a cabin out here in Ouray, they used the cruiser as there transportation while in Ouray, after this it changed hands to a friend of mine that I purchased it from after several months of begging. I have the original warranty card from being purchased back on 01/24/1977, and also the orignal 1977 owners manual. As stated all electrical and switches work like new. Rear heater, front heater, wipers, choke works exactly as it should. Motor has great oil pressure, doesn't burn oil, nor smokes at all. It is a 4 speed manual, clutch is smooth and easy to run thru gears. The tires 31 x 10.50 Goodyear Wrangler MTR's have less then 500 miles on them, the spare has never been used. Shocks are new as well. The rust is minimal and is shown in the pictures. The worst is the rear rail which can be replaced thru many outfitters. The floorpans are solid, as well as all other areas. The top has a small dent in the rear passenger side, please note pic. Its not bad but want to state all items, and finally the hoods paint is faded. The top is solid, the door window cranks and latches work as they should. Lastly the windshield is cracked, which is common here in Colorado. The front seats do have some tears as shown, but are original. This is one of those rare unmolested, original cruisers, that runs, drives and goes down the road as good as a new one. Like I stated I would drive this anywhere, albeit at about 60mph, with the gearing thats where it wants to be. But it is smooth and comfortable at this speed.
